The Village and Town of Fishkill are located in southern Dutchess County, New York, in the scenic Mid-Hudson Region of the Hudson River Valley. First settled in the early 1700’s, the Town of Fishkill was created in 1788, while the Village of Fishkill was incorporated in 1899. The kill part in the name is actually the Dutch word for stream or creek and is common in the names of many communities in the area, which was settled by the Dutch in the early 1600's.
